The Last Shoes of Professor Marvellian

A true Hornby production was presented to us this past weekend.  A play titled "The Last Shoes of Professor Marvellian" was performed by an all age cast. 
Spearheaded by Andrea Kaback with many, many fellow workers, this play was truely magical. Starring Richard Laskin, Zsofin Sheehy, Lorne Sutherland and a very large group of amazing youth.

Hornby Fall Faire 2010 at Olsen's Farm

If you have not ever been to the Hornby Fall Faire, you are missing the event of the year.On the third Sunday in September, we gather to enjoy an old fashioned fall faire.  Local music, auctions, and skits on the stage for entertainment.  Kids races and games plus more.  This year's theme was "Bees". 
The  Faire begins with a wonderful parade.

Many groups set up displays and tents as well as the farmer's market vendors also sell and display their wares.  Fabulous pies, corn on the cob, soups and more are available from some of the non profit groups.


Of course we have also have local animals on display, chickens, goats, sheep, horses, donkey (see Dovie below) and there is the friendly competition to see who has the nicest tomatoes, jams, flowers etc...
